YAGO 4: A Reason-able Knowledge Base

Abstract

YAGO is one of the large knowledge bases in the Linked Open Data cloud. In this resource paper, we present its latest version, YAGO 4, which reconciles the rigorous typing and constraints of schema.org with the rich instance data of Wikidata. The resulting resource contains 2 billion type-consistent triples for 64 Million entities, and has a consistent ontology that allows semantic reasoning with OWL 2 description logics.
